Output de8578bbb3fd83a2d5be153f63dcd085c35c4a48ed2e6dffb80d7593f85aed94:2

value
766321119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d21911c14b64d99eaa2481a64f31c4a45ffca809 OP_EQUAL
address
MT44AZfNKX2h4bBWBxwvoMKKwi6k42ZLhk
transaction
de8578bbb3fd83a2d5be153f63dcd085c35c4a48ed2e6dffb80d7593f85aed94
spent
true